 <description>&lt;p&gt;I&#039;ve been following developments in Filipino rap culture over the past few years, in part because I enjoy listening to rap, but also because there&#039;s this fascinating way that the rap battle format has certain similarities to the Filipino tradition of poetic debate called Balagtasan, so that battles in the Philippines incorporate certain elements of that tradition.&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://arcade.stanford.edu/poets-funny-places&quot;&gt;read more&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/p&gt;</description>
